Abstract
•Electrochemical oxidation of pyrite occurred by two reaction pathways.•At potential of 0.50V, electrochemical oxidation of pyrite was diffusion-limited.•At potential of 0.60V, amorphous S8 was slowly converted to crystalline S8.•S8 was difficult to be oxidized electrochemically even at high potential.•Oxidation of pyrite was inhomogeneous on electrode surface.
